Camouflage by Steve Parker

Animal Disguises

In this engaging exploration of the natural world, readers are introduced to the fascinating concept of camouflage and its vital role in the survival of various species. The book delves into the myriad ways animals and plants have evolved to blend seamlessly into their environments, from the intricate patterns on a butterfly's wings to the deceptive mimicry of certain plants. Through vivid illustrations and insightful explanations, the narrative highlights the ingenious strategies employed by nature to evade predators, capture prey, and thrive in diverse habitats, offering a captivating glimpse into the art of concealment in the animal kingdom.
